So here we are, one year ago today I was stepping foot off the aeroplane into Australia for the very first time. We had never visited before, had no friends or family here, just a job and a 457 visa. Me, OH, and our two little girls 2.5 years and a 12 week old.

Its been an interesting Year, some days it feels like I arrived yesterday and other days I feel as though I have been here a life time.

Both me and OH have struggled through winter with what I suppose is homesickness, and we have discussed moving back on occasion.

On the up side though, there are many things about this place that we love, we are just starting to feel more settled. OH doing well at work and has had a promotion. Kids settled well into kindy and general day to day life. I am feeling very relaxed and happy (most days).
Our social life has been slow in taking off, mainly because we arrived with a 12 week old baby.... Its hard to get out when you dont have a babysitter. We have now found a great babysitter and are starting to develop a social life which is good.
OH started to learn to play golf, I have joined a gym (and lost 3.5 stones so far... Go me)!!!!! So we are getting out there and getting involved.

Overall we are doing well here. The jury is still out as to find out if this is our forever place, but we feel that its way too early to call. After 12 months we have managed to just get settled, and maybe over the next 12 -24 months we can start to see how we feel and what we want for the future.

But right now, as I type, I feel settled and content and ready for the next chapter.
